Adding new vendor attributes retriggers the Stripe onboarding process

When a user has completed the Stripe onboarding process and gotten a Stripe Connected account, creating a new required vendor attribute triggers the vendor registration form again for that user, with the “continue to stripe” button at the bottom.

Clicking this button creates a brand new, connected account with a new Stripe ID rather than utilizing the old connected account with all the required details.

The main issue here is that adding a new, required vendor attributes triggers the form with the “connect to stripe” button instead of the “save changes” button for users that has already completed the onboarding process.

Thanks for reporting this issue, we’ll re-test this locally, if there’s a bug we’ll fix this in the next Marketplace update.